  DECtape 
 
    A  reel  of  {magnetic  tape}  about  4  inches 
  in  diameter  and  one  inch  wide.  Unlike  today's  {macrotapes}, 
  microtape  drivers  allowed  {random  access}  to  the  data,  and 
  therefore  could  be  used  to  support  {file  systems}  and  even  for 
  {swapping}  (this  was  generally  done  purely  for  {hack  value}, 
  as  they  were  far  too  slow  for  practical  use).  DECtape  was  a 
  variant  on  {LINCtape}. 
 
  In  their  heyday  DECtapes  were  used  in  pretty  much  the  same 
  ways  one  would  now  use  a  {floppy  disk}:  as  a  small  portable 
  way  to  save  and  transport  files  and  programs.
